Whether you're making a mini lipstick for travel sets or a full-size tube for everyday wear, we've got the dimensions to match. Our most popular options include:
| Diameter (Base) | Standard Capacity | Best For | Minimum Order (MOQ)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 12mm (Slim) | 3.5g | Travel-sized, matte formulas | 5,000 units |
| 14mm (Standard) | 4.0g | Everyday wear, cream/lipstick hybrids | 5,000 units |
| 16mm (Jumbo) | 4.5g | Luxury lines, bold pigments | 5,000 units |

We use high-quality PP (polypropylene) and HDPE (high-density polyethylene) for our tubes—both BPA-free, non-toxic, and built to handle the rigors of shipping and daily use. PP is lightweight but tough, so your tubes won't crack if they get dropped in a purse. HDPE adds a bit more heft, which feels premium in the hand—perfect if you're positioning your brand as luxury on a budget.
And hey, we get the push for sustainability. That's why we now offer PCR (post-consumer recycled) plastic options for brands that want to reduce their environmental footprint. It's the same great quality, just made with 30-50% recycled material—something your eco-conscious customers will love seeing on your packaging.
